Output ec963a5903beeff14bf94ceec2a6f0c5209b50e6773b4ff979fe53dbd5df8651:1

value
18447800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b1eb6810b0c443626c630283d4db40facca74b2 OP_EQUAL
address
3FqDTFKGYW8WRDhe9dotSyN1xoxfAaNahL
transaction
ec963a5903beeff14bf94ceec2a6f0c5209b50e6773b4ff979fe53dbd5df8651
spent
true